Transaction af65b58d6f2acd70330719d73de4800a168c37f97961768d8eeb943d36f3178a

4 Input
1 Outputs
  • af65b58d6f2acd70330719d73de4800a168c37f97961768d8eeb943d36f3178a:0
  • value  235364
    address  3Qz8M8ey4dz7PbAUNHCis8hLD3AP3SWwTw